Building Cost-Efficient Computer-Aided Learning Environments via Virtualization and Service-Based Software
نویسندگان
چکیده
With increasing and various pedagogical activities are conducted within them, computer-aided learning environments play significant roles in educational institutes, enterprises, and organizations. The cost of operating computer-aided learning environments inevitably goes up along with increasing demands from instructors and learners. Consequently, it is a critical issue to figure out how to provision these pivotal environments more cost-efficiently without compromising service level and users experience. This article elaborates how the two key enabling techniques of cloud computing: system virtualization and web service could be applied to create an agile computeraided learning environments with improved cost-efficiency.
منابع مشابه
Energy Aware Resource Management of Cloud Data Centers
Cloud Computing, the long-held dream of computing as a utility, has the potential to transform a large part of the IT industry, making software even more attractive as a service and shaping the way IT hardware is designed and purchased. Virtualization technology forms a key concept for new cloud computing architectures. The data centers are used to provide cloud services burdening a significant...
متن کاملA review of methods for resource allocation and operational framework in cloud computing
The issue of management and allocation of resources in cloud computing environments, according to the breadth of scale and modern technology implementation, is a complicated issue. Issues such as: the heterogeneity of resources, resource dependencies to each other, the dynamics of the environment, virtualization, workload diversity as well as a wide range of management objectives of cloud servi...
متن کاملA New Optimized Hybrid Model Based On COCOMO to Increase the Accuracy of Software Cost Estimation
The literature review shows software development projects often neither meet time deadlines, nor run within the allocated budgets. One common reason can be the inaccurate cost estimation process, although several approaches have been proposed in this field. Recent research studies suggest that in order to increase the accuracy of this process, estimation models have to be revised. The Construct...
متن کاملEfficiency Sustainability Resource Visual Simulator for Clustered Desktop Virtualization Based on Cloud Infrastructure
Following IT innovations, manual operations have been automated, improving the overall quality of life. This has been possible because an organic topology has been formed among many diverse smart devices grafted onto real life. To provide services to these smart devices, enterprises or users use the cloud. Cloud services are divided into infrastructure as a service (IaaS), platform as a service...
متن کاملOrchestrating Service Function Chaining in Cloud Environments
The rapid emergence of Software Defined Networks (SDN) and Network Function Virtualization (NFV) concepts is enabling the innovation of cloud infrastructures for supporting real time services and applications. Interconnecting Service Functions (SFs) in a specific ordered way to support applications’ requirements is defining the concept of Service Function Chaining (SFC). SFC uses those evolved ...
متن کامل